Duties
Provide support and input for the coordination of administrative services (e.g., scheduling, templates, staffing, and training) performed within the health care facilities or offices.
Enter, upload maintain, review, and/or update health care records (e.g., patient data, patient identifiers).
Assess patients' administrative needs and provide guidance or assistance in resolving patient concerns.
Ability to provide clear and concise directions for patient care.
Perform clerical duties utilizing health care automated software.

Qualifications
Who May Apply: US Citizens
In order to qualify, you must meet the education and/or experience requirements described below. Experience refers to paid and unpaid experience, including volunteer work done through National Service programs (e.g., Peace Corps, AmeriCorps) and other organizations (e.g., professional; philanthropic; religious; spiritual; community; student; social). You will receive credit for all qualifying experience, including volunteer experience. Your resume must clearly describe your relevant experience; if qualifying based on education, your transcripts will be required as part of your application. Additional information about transcripts is in this document.
Specialized Experience: One year of specialized experience which includes performing customer service functions, such as answering telephones, relaying messages, and resolving customer complaints; scheduling appointments using automated or digital scheduling systems; maintaining organized files in both electronic and paper formats; and utilizing a personal computer and software programs to create documents, reports, and other work products. This definition of specialized experience is typical of work performed at the next lower grade/level position in the federal service (GS-04).
OR
Education: Four year course of study leading to a bachelor's degree.
OR
Combination of Education and Experience: A combination of education and experience may be used to qualify for this position as long as the computed percentage of the requirements is at least 100%. To compute the percentage of the requirements, divide your total months of experience by 12. Then divide your semester hours of education beyond two years (total semester hours minus 60) by 60. Add the two percentages.
Qualified typist is required (40 wpm)
